The earliest memory I have of playing any particular DDR song was... well, pretty much the first song: Have You Never Been Mellow, on a 1stMIX machine in Wildwood, NJ in summer 2002. I remembered failing it -- yes, one of the easiest Basic charts of all time... although in retrospect, I may have actually been playing on Easy Mode, which limits you to one song, pass or fail.

My first dance game experience overall was on a Pump It Up Premiere (EX?) machine months beforehand, but I can't remember what song(s) I played then. I do definitely remember beefing them, though.

The Whistle Song (Blow My Whistle Bitch) on a Max 2 machine in a truck stop somewhere on the way home from a vacation on the east coast. I remember thinking how crazy it was that the other people were playing songs on crazy high difficulty, and me and my sister played one song and left. A year or so down the line I had this weird idea that maybe that game would be available to buy on some kind of system and asked around and found out that it was on PS2. Me and two friends played hookie (literally the only time I ever did) and my dad drove us up to the nearest town with a GameStop and we purchased DDR Max with a pad. I've been wildly addicted since. I used to play every day either at home or driving up to the arcades in Springfield MO, or eventually to STL, KC, and Kirksville for lots of tournaments. I still play any time I find a machine, or if I drive up to KC to their Round 1, but all the machines near me, including my Solo 2000, are no longer operable. I've debated making a Stepmania machine multiple times, but always had very bad luck with big metal pads.
